Let √7 be a rational number say p/q where q is not equal to zero and p and q are coprime. √7=p/q Sq. Both side 7=p²/q², 7q²=p²--------(1) 7q² is divisible by 7, p² is divisible by 7, p is divisible by 7, Let p=7a, Putting the value in equation 1. 7q²=(7a)² 7q²=49a² q²=7a² 7a²is divisible by 7 q² is divisible by 7 q is divisible by 7 Both p and q have common factor 7. Therefore our supposition is wrong. √7 is irrational.
